Albion have confirmed the signing of Norwegian teenager Henrik Bjordal.
The 18-year-old has joined the Seagulls from Aalesunds for an undisclosed fee on a two-and-a-half-year contract.
Manager Chris Hughton has urged Bjordal to show he is capable of making the step up from initial involvement in the under-21s squad to the first team ranks.
Hughton said: "He's an exciting young prospect, a quick player who can play as a winger or attacking midfielder.
"He already has a good deal of experience for his age, having played a great number of games at senior level in Norway's top division.
"He broke through to the senior team in Norway at a very young age and established himself quickly at his club. He will begin with our under-21 squad and has the opportunity to make that step up into our first team squad."
